Install the Lucid Cards for monday.com integration
To install the monday.com integration:
- Go to the Lucid Integration Marketplace.
- Select Lucidspark at the top of the page.
- Search “monday.com”.
- Click Start.
- Click Install in the window that appears.
Import items as Lucid Cards
To import monday.com items into Lucidspark as Lucid Cards, follow these steps:
- Click
the More tools icon from the Primary Toolbar on the left-side of the canvas.
- Select
the monday.com icon from the menu that appears.
- Click Import monday.com items.
- Choose a workspace from the “Workspace” dropdown.
- Select a board from the “Board” dropdown.
- Enter a search term into the field or leave it blank to return all rows.
- Check the box next to any items you want to import into Lucidspark.
- Click Import # issues at the bottom-right corner.
FAQ
I’m getting an error when linking Lucidspark with monday.com. How do I fix it?
You need to install the Lucid app in monday.com before using the integration in Lucidspark. If you receive a message in monday.com that you are not allowed to install the Lucid app, please contact your monday.com admin and request that they install it for your account.
Will my cards update automatically in Lucidspark?
No. To see changes made in monday.com reflected in Lucidspark, you need to re-import the items by following the "Import items as Lucid Cards" steps listed above.
Can I edit my cards after importing them from monday.com?
No. To edit a field in a Lucid Card, make the change in monday.com and re-import the items.
Is this integration available in multiple languages?
No. The Lucid Cards integration with monday.com is currently available in English only.
